Ethical Arts on a Planetary Scale: How Can We Achieve Well-Being for Everyone?
This webinar explores practices and ideas to support human well-being globally. Participants will explore approaches at the intersection of art, ethics, and sustainable development: from sustainability arts initiatives to body-based practices and philosophical reflection on ethical behavior. Speakers will present diverse perspectives—research, practice, and theory—and discuss how personal actions can impact a shared future. The webinar creates a space for dialogue, questions, and the collaborative search for solutions aimed at the harmonious coexistence of people, society, and the planet.

Speakers
Alena Maslova
Convenor and Moderator
An international expert in sustainability arts, social and behavior change communication (SBCC), and cultural reform. As the founder of Dobrosphera, she leads initiatives that leverage the power of culture, media, and the arts to champion ecological sustainability and global well-being. Maslova is a recognized figure in global climate action, serving as a speaker at COP28 and an organizer for subsequent UN Climate Change Conferences, including COP29 and COP30. Her work focuses on connecting international networks, hosting conferences like “Hi, Sustainable World,” and uniting global leaders, youth organizations, and founders to advance regenerative ecosystems.
Natalia Sonina
A facilitator, explorer, and practitioner dedicated to blending external impact, inner balance, and interconnected mysticism. For over a decade, she has guided transformative processes across creative startups, non-profits, technology, art, and regenerative sustainability. Rather than a traditional changemaker, Sonina views herself as a vessel for change, supporting others in building a better world. Her holistic practice leverages business, coaching, yoga, and mental health. By integrating archetypes, embodiment cycles, leadership visions, and creative flow, Sonina helps individuals unlock their inherent human potential and reconnect with their natural power.
Sofia Danko
An international philosopher specializing in logic and ethics, and a candidate of philosophical sciences. She is known for her lectures and research on the philosophy of Ludwig Wittgenstein, the problems of the subject, free will, and transcendental philosophy. Currently, Sofia teaches the course “Ethics: A Course on Good and Evil,” which explores, in both theoretical and practical terms, issues of moral choice, responsibility, the nature of good and evil, and how ethical systems influence everyday life.
